Basic HTML is something that everybody needs to know nowadays who want to get the full benefit of all the lovely and interactive websites out there. If you want to blog, keep an LJ (LiveJournal), post on forums or communities in many cases you can get by without knowing any code whatsoever, but just knowing a line or two of HTML will make life so much easier for you.
So you want to learn HTML?